Minnesota Vikings quarterback J.J. McCarthy is doing a lot of the right things to get himself ready to take over as the starting quarterback. The Vikings have all the faith in the world in McCarthy, and their actions have proven that.
One of the things that McCarthy has done is spend a lot of time with wide receiver Justin Jefferson. McCarthy understands that building a rapport with the best wide receiver in the game is important.
He also gets the little things that need to be done, including developing chemistry with his center Ryan Kelly. It's an underrated relationship when it comes to the success of the offense, and he talked about spending time with him
"[I spent] a good amount of time with Ryan Kelly. We met a couple times with Coach Kup [Chris Kuper] and just went over just little things about the offense, base stuff, and just be on the same page with that. And it's a continued process. That relationship is going to grow throughout the remainder of this off season and the entire season. So, I'm very excited. He's an absolute stud. I can’t wait to get Will [Fries] out here and Justin [Skule] has been fantastic. Great additions to the room. Donnie [Donavan Jackson] got some time today. So, it's been really awesome having those guys."
McCarthy showing this level of intelligence and maturity throughout this offseason has been a great thing to see. Everything so far has signaled that the Vikings have made the right call, and McCarthy is proving them right so far.
